A young woman from Vihiga County has sparked national conversation after a distressing video of her speaking about her health condition went viral on social media.
In the clip, the woman is heard saying, “Aki nimechoka kumeza hizi dawa, naumia” (I am tired of taking these drugs, I am in pain), drawing sympathy and concern from Kenyans online.
According to reports circulating online, the woman claims her situation is linked to a past relationship with a senior and influential individual, described as a “top politician.” While these claims have not been independently verified, they have reignited debate around exploitation, power dynamics, and accountability.
The woman is currently undergoing treatment and is said to be on Antiretroviral (ARV) therapy, which is used in the management of HIV. Health experts note that while ARVs significantly improve quality of life and longevity, long-term treatment can be physically and emotionally demanding for patients.
Her case has brought attention to the broader issue of transactional relationships, particularly those involving young people and individuals in positions of power. Advocacy groups warn that such situations often expose vulnerable individuals to health risks, emotional distress, and, in some cases, long-term consequences.
In Kenya, the law criminalizes the intentional transmission of HIV. However, experts say that many cases go unreported due to stigma, fear, and the influence of those involved.
Public health officials continue to emphasize the importance of regular testing, transparency between partners, and access to counseling services. They also call for greater awareness, especially among young people, about the risks associated with relationships driven by financial or material gain.
The viral story has also prompted calls for compassion and support for individuals living with chronic illnesses, with many urging the public to avoid stigma and instead encourage access to care and treatment.
As the story continues to unfold, authorities have not released any official statement regarding the allegations.
